The Lincoln City Council is considering two parking ordinances – “residential parking pass areas” and the criteria for creating “no parking zones.” Public input prior to adoption is very important. The City Manager will hold a series of small gatherings to explain the proposed ordinances, answer questions and receive public input. These meetings are not City Council meetings but will be meetings with staff to explain the proposed ordinances, answer questions and receive input. This information will be given to the City Council during a regularly scheduled City Council meeting on a later date.
These meetings may be held electronically, in the neighborhoods or at the City offices. The preferable way to meet will be electronically (i.e. Zoom meeting). All COVID-19 restrictions – meeting size, face coverings, social distancing, etc. – will apply for in person meetings.
